Manufacturing and construction teams often work across multiple locations, with staff needing secure access to documents, drawings, schedules, and email. Poorly managed access can create delays, confusion, and unnecessary exposure to data risk.
Your technology environment may involve software vendors, telecoms providers, printers, connectivity suppliers, and specialist operational systems. Without clear ownership, problems can bounce between providers while your staff wait for answers.
Phishing, ransomware, and Microsoft 365 account compromise can create serious operational and financial disruption. A security-first IT approach helps strengthen protection while supporting frameworks such as Cyber Essentials where relevant.

Our process starts with a consultation and technical review to understand your systems, risks, priorities, and current frustrations. During onboarding, we document the environment, audit key systems, review security, verify backups, deploy monitoring where appropriate, and improve user setup. We aim to make the transition structured and clear, with minimal disruption to day-to-day work.
